What can I use to clean my microfiber couch

For a water-safe couch, make a solution of a quart of warm water with a tablespoon of dish soap and stir it up vigorously to make suds. Dip a sponge or cloth into only the suds; do not wet the sponge. Rub in a circular motion, then blot with a clean dry cloth. Refresh suds as needed to clean entire surface.

How do you clean a microfiber couch?

To clean a microfiber couch that is not water safe you will need rubbing alcohol. This works because rubbing alcohol evaporates so quickly. Fill a spray bottle with rubbing alcohol and spray any stains or spots on the couch. Then rub each spot with a white cloth or sponge until clean.

How do you clean a microfiber couch without rubbing alcohol?

Some microfiber stains require a bit of gently scrubbing. A paste of baking soda and water gives you the light scrubbing action you need to gently remove ink and other stains from your microfiber couch. Simply apply the paste to the stain and gently rub with your finger or a cleaning cloth.

How do you get drool out of microfiber couch?

Cover a fresh saliva stain with baking soda or salt to absorb the saliva and prevent stains. Leave the dry ingredient in place for 20 minutes then vacuum off the upholstery. Dampen a dry saliva stain with club soda before proceeding to remove the stain.

Will rubbing alcohol ruin microfiber?

Rubbing alcohol should not leave a mark on microfiber; however, it is always a good idea to test the fabric before applying rubbing alcohol to the entire item. For example, if you are cleaning a microfiber couch, test a small piece of material on the back of the couch that is not visible.

How do you clean a microfiber couch with baking soda?

  1. Sprinkle dry baking soda over the entire couch.
  2. Brush the baking soda into the microfiber with a soft scrub brush. This allows the baking soda to reach deeper into the microfiber. Leave the baking soda on the couch for 1 hour.
  3. Vacuum the couch to remove the baking soda and the odors it absorbed.

How long does microfiber couch last?

A quality leather couch should last 25+ years, a microfiber couch typically lasts 7 – 10 years and a faux leather couch will last roughly 3 – 5 years. It’s important to keep in mind that the longevity of a couch will depend on how well it’s taken care of.

How do you deep clean a couch upholstery?

For this, you’d need to make a cleaning solution first. What you’d want to do is mix ¾ cup of warm water, ¼ cup of vinegar and a tablespoon of dish soap of any scent. This mixture works well with fabric upholstery. If you have synthetic upholstery, mix one cup warm water, ½ cup vinegar, and ½ tablespoon of dish soap.
